Stress is a neuron growth killer. Literally.
Stress leads to atrophy and loss of neurons.
And not just white matter. These are pyramidal cells in grey matter which are not sheathed in myelin. You can see how the cell on the left has more growth, and this image doesn’t even show dendritic spining, the process that yields new synapses. The cell on the right comes from an animal that experiences higher levels of stress and you can see the decreased overall branching and shorter axon lengths.
It’s also important to talk about neural plasticity.
Think of white matter as a set of telephone wires that connect regions of the brain. Loss of integrity includes reduced myelination and atrophy in size of axons, which is directly correlated with ability of neuron to transmit impulses. In a study by John Morrison at Mount Sinai School of medicine, stressed rats were documented taking longer to recognize new patterns than rats with less stress.
To give you a sense of the importance of white matter, this is a tensor diffusion image of white matter connectivity. You can see that every part of the brain requires white matter signal transduction. A study by University of Kentucky on white matter found that elderly people who are at risk for Alzheimers but don’t yet show symptoms show both reduced axonal and myelin integrity in critical white matter regions responsible for connecting gray matter regions responsible for memory formation.

Perspective. The way we see the world influences the way we perceive it to be. For example, let’s look at a study performed by Yale University.
Researchers at Yale did a study on fullness. They gave one group a smoothie that was a ‘sensible’ 140 calories, a control group had a 380 cal smoothie and a third group consumed a 620 cal “indulgent” smoothie. Nor surprisingly, the group that consumed the low-cal smoothie experienced a reduced release of the hormone ghrelin, which regulates appetite. The reverse was true for the group that drank the 620 cal smoothie. Their bodies released more of the fullness hormone and they consequently reported feeling more full. The surprising part?

Cognitive Appraisal, a term originally coined by Richard Lazarus of UC Berkeley, is thesubjective assessment of situational demands and available resources, aka your perception of a situation.

Threat: Possible future damage that the event may cause.Challenge: The potential to overcome and even profit from the event.
Sleep allows the brain to process memories and grow new connections formed during the day. Your brain is far from silent while you are sleeping. You have 4 stages of sleep plus REM which accounts for 20 percent of sleep time. REM is deep sleep is is thought to play a key role in maintaining a healthy brain. According to the NIH, during sleep, growth hormones are released, neurotransmitters are synthesized, protein breakdown in cells slows, and toxins from daily activities are flushed.
Lack of sleep impairs immune function and can have peculiar side effects like boosting hunger and appetite.

When your body lacks water, brain cells and other neurons shrink and biochemical processes involved in cellular communication slow. A drop of as little as 1 to 2% of fluid levels can result in slower processing speeds, impaired short-term memory, tweaked visual tracking and deficits in attention. Water is also important to remove toxins. Via Gregory Kellett, neuroscientist at UCSF.
As rebecca mentioned. B Vitamins and zinc are key to making neurotransmitters like serotonin and GABA; zinc plays a central role in the growth of new neurons

Phytonutrients, are plant compounds that have tremendous health benefits for the brain. Thesepigmentd molecules from colored fruits and veggies are loaded with antioxidants and even carry active enzymes that can enhance the efficience of the biochemical machine happening in your body right now. To give you a sense of the scale of how much is happening in your body, consider that every 60seconds your bone marrow creates 120 MILLION red blood cells AND 7 MILLION white blood cells. Kale. Healthy body, healthy mind. It’s also important to note that consuming whole, unprocessed foods helps maintain a healthy gut bacteria flora. There are more non-human cells in your body than human ones, and the 100 trillion bacteria in your gut paly a crucial role in nutrient absorption and even influence production many neurotransmitters, such as serotonin, 90% of which is used by your enteric nervous system.

Awe. Researchers at Stanford Graduate School of Business recently performed a landmark study on the biological benefits of awe, which range from the expansion of perception of time to increased patience; awe boosts decision making ability and well-being.
